Simmons Foods, Inc., a prominent player in the poultry and pet food industries, is headquartered in the United States. Founded in 1954, the company has established itself as a leader in providing high-quality chicken products and innovative pet food solutions. With major operations across the US, Simmons Foods focuses on sustainable practices and superior product quality, setting it apart in a competitive market. The company’s core offerings include fresh and frozen chicken, as well as a diverse range of pet food products, catering to both retail and food service sectors. Simmons Foods, Inc.'s reported carbon emissions

Simmons Foods, Inc., headquartered in the US, currently does not have publicly available carbon emissions data for the most recent year, nor does it report specific reduction targets or initiatives. The company has not established any Science-Based Targets Initiative (SBTi) reduction targets or documented climate pledges. As such, there are no specific figures regarding their carbon emissions, including Scope 1, 2, or 3 emissions.
